Security: Making the Unknown, Known

January 17, 2022/by Adnan Hamid

There is no known way to guarantee that a system is secure. Vulnerabilities exist in hardware, software, and throughout the supply chain. They may exist by accident or by ignorance. They may have been inserted maliciously, or they may utilize some mechanism never before considered part of the attack plane. There is no one method by which all these potential issues can be addressed, and no tool that can find them all.

Security has often been likened to a castle. You build layers of protection and while you expect some to be breached, you make it increasingly difficult to get the ultimate prize. Verification has a role to play in exposing vulnerabilities, but the problem is that entrenched dynamic verification methodologies have difficulties with this. Technologies are needed that can produce testcases which demonstrate a weakness. Formal verification is one that has been successfully used for this.

Breker Verification Systems Unveils System Coherency Synthesis TrekApp, Building on Its Successful Cache Coherency Test Solution

December 6, 2021/by becbrek

System Coherency Synthesis TrekApp Generates High Coverage Tests to Stress Coherency, Detect Corner Cases for Range of SoC Platforms, Processors

AT DESIGN AUTOMATION CONFERENCE BOOTH #2528

SAN JOSE, CALIF. –– December 6, 2021 –– Breker Verification Systems today unveiled its System Coherency Synthesis TrekApp used to generate thousands of high-coverage tests to stress cross-system coherency for a broad range of SoC platforms and processors.

Based on Breker’s Cache Coherency TrekApp, the System Coherency Synthesis TrekApp uses abstract models of common and novel algorithms to automatically generate coherency test content for complex, multi-agent system platforms based on coverage directives. The TrekApp can be configured for Arm, RISC-V and other processor configurations and broad range of storage and I/O architectures.

Inside Portable Stimulus — Hardware Software Interface

November 30, 2021/by Leigh Brady

This blog series has stuck to what is in the Accellera Portable Stimulus 1.0 standard (PSS), but in this particular blog, we will deviate a bit. We will discuss a capability that did not make it into the first release of the standard, the Hardware Software Interface (HSI). It is a critical capability that now has the full attention of the Accellera Portable Stimulus Working Group (PSWG). Its absence results in extra work for companies that want to adopt Portable Stimulus tools without some form of this functionality.

The problem is easiest to understand by thinking about test portability. By that, we mean the ability to go from a single description of test intent and to execute that test, without modification, on a variety of execution engines. Those execution engines include simulators, running at either the transaction level or register transfer level (RTL), emulators, prototyping solutions, virtual platforms, and real silicon. Now, consider a test that needs to get data into a certain register or memory location or retrieve the contents of that register or memory to ensure that a test operated correctly.

Verifying AI Engines

September 20, 2021/by Adnan Hamid

It has been said that there are more than 100 companies currently developing custom hardware engines that can accelerate the machine learning (ML) function. Some target the data center where huge amounts of algorithm development and training are being performed. Power consumption has become one of the largest cost components of training, often utilizing large numbers of high-end GPUs and FPGAs to perform the task today. It is hoped that dedicated accelerators will be able to both speed up this function and perform it using a fraction of the power. Algorithms and networks are evolving so rapidly that these devices must retain maximum flexibility.

Other accelerators focus on the inference problem that runs input sets through a trained network to produce a classification. Most are deployed in the field where power, performance and accuracy are being optimized. Many are designed for a particular class of problem, such as audio or vision, and being targeted at segments including consumer, automotive or the IoT. Each restricts the flexibility that is necessary. Flexibility becomes a design optimization choice – the more that is fixed in hardware means greater performance or lower power but the software side is less amenable to change.
